Notice of Letting Contract for Completing Stone Roads. No. 2849. Notice Is hereby given that the Contractors, Glidewell Son, having failed to complete the work of constructing the Gillam Gravel Roads, petitioned for by Larkin C. Logan, et al. within the time specified in the contract and within the time extended by the Board of Commissioners, the Board of Commissioners of Jasper County, Indiana, will on Wednesday, the 7th day of October, until 12 o’clock noon, receive sealed proposals for the completion of said roads, according to plans and specifications on file in the Auditor’s office. Said uncompleted portion is as as follows:—Near Independence church, at or near stake 78 plus 50 to stake 85 plus 39, a distance of 689 feet, has not been graveled; from stake 133 plus 25 to stake 171 plus 65, a distance of 3,843 feet has not been graveled; from stake 335 to stake 350 a shortage of 94 1-3 yards of gravel. Making a total of 1,604 yards to complete work. Bidders will be required to file bond and affidavit as provided by law. The Board of Commissioners reserve the right to reject any and all bids. By order of the Board of Commissioners of Jasper county. JAMES N. LEATHERMAN, Auditor Jasper County. NOTICE OF ADMINISTRATION.
